A Lebanese Communist Party member shows off his tattoo

A Lebanese Communist Party member shows off his tattoo

A Lebanese Communist Party member shows off his tattoo at a rally in Beirut on Sept, 16, 2009

A Lebanese Communist Party member shows off his tattoo at a rally in Beirut on Sept, 16, 2009

Leave a comment